Researched to send review to manager b4 posting but unable to find contact info. Marriott Kansas City Airport ROOM 706: May 21-23, 2022 $473.12 – two nights (including expensive water and items from store to eat in room) Room as though hadn’t been used in some time – dust. Shower would not drain for quite some time and then overflowed into bathroom. Did not notice as had eyes closed to wash face. Then heard a gurgling sound and looked at drain – it eventually drained but not until had flooded outside shower onto floor. Used many towels to cover water so would not slip and fall. In lavatory were some kind of raised smudges so cleaned sink upon check in. There were two refrigerators in the room – not sure why. The larger of the two had a great deal of frost in the freezer. The smaller one top was dirty; inside had fingerprint smudges. Cleaned both refrigerators as well. Overall, the room was not very clean. I cleaned everything in the room that would have been touched by hands or feet. That includes the toilets. There were two towels that had dead winged insect of some kind on them; they were used to mop up water overflow from stopped up drain in shower. I arrived very late in the early morning hours. I had asked for a quiet room. Apparently, the people on the other side, #704 maybe were quite noisy? Must have been opening and closing the barn door until even earlier wee hours of the morning. What a terrible concept for a hotel room unless some type of bumper to prevent the noise. I got very little rest that night after travelling from Florida beginning at about 1:45 PM EST. The amenities? Very lacking. Not even a shower cap. For the price of the room, one would expect better. In addition, not even water was offered as an amenity: $2.50/bottle is steep. After traveling one wants good clean water. No room service. So, $3.00 for a tasteless muffin. The website indicates the following: “Savor a meal from the privacy of your guest quarters thanks to our convenient room service options.” No bellhop. An engineer was called to assist checking out. ROOM 806: May 28-29, 2022 ($205 plus taxes) – one night $242.84 (including $19.54 for food to take to room & expensive food/water for room) More issues with this room – it was even dirtier and again seemed as though had not been used in quite some time. The hangers were covered in dust. I was too tired to clean them to hang my clothes on. Upon walking in the room had the most musty smell – the smell of sour water causing my nose to run. The bag for the hair dryer as was the hair dryer itself very dusty. Someone else’s hair was on the sheet of one bed. Again, I had to clean the sink. In fact, a total cleaning of room. Broken lampshade. Again, no bellhop. Scanty amenities. No room service. Most of the staff were great. The shuttle drivers were very courteous and helpful.
